IDataModelScriptDebug2::SetEventFilter 方法 (dbgmodel.h)
SetEventFilter 方法會變更 ScriptDebugEventFilter 列舉成員所定義之特定事件的「中斷事件」行為。 如需可用事件的完整清單 (,以及此列舉) 的說明,請參閱 GetEventFilter 方法的檔。
如果腳本調試程式不支援特定事件類型,可能會傳回E_NOTIMPL。
只要腳本調試程式是透過 StartDebugging 方法的呼叫來啟用,呼叫此方法是合法的。
語法
HRESULT SetEventFilter(
ScriptDebugEventFilter eventFilter,
bool isBreakEnabled
);
參數
eventFilter
指出正在變更「事件中斷」行為的事件。 事件定義為 ScriptDebugEventFilter 列舉的成員。
isBreakEnabled
如果為 true,表示呼叫端希望調試程式在發生指定的事件時中斷調試程式;如果為 false,表示呼叫端不希望調試程式在發生指定的事件時中斷調試程式。
傳回值
這個方法會傳回 HRESULT,指出成功或失敗。
規格需求
需求 | 值 |
---|---|
標頭 | dbgmodel.h |